body div{font-family:Roboto,Sans-serif}body div h1,body div h2,body div h3,body div h4,body div h5,body div h6{font-family:Avenir Next,Sans-serif;font-weight:700}.sub-trigger.triggered~ul.haus-button-sub-list li{transform:translateY(-10px);opacity:0;animation:slide-down .5s ease forwards}.sub-trigger.triggered~ul.haus-button-sub-list li a,body #cookie-notice{box-shadow:0 0 20px rgba(0,0,0,.25)}body #cookie-notice .cookie-notice-container .elementor-button.cookie-button{background-color:#ef7e65;font-weight:400}body #cookie-notice .cookie-notice-container a,body #cookie-notice .cookie-notice-container a:hover{color:#fff}.elementor-widget-document-widget .document-part{margin-bottom:30px}.elementor-widget-document-widget .document-part h1,.elementor-widget-document-widget .document-part h2,.elementor-widget-document-widget .document-part h3,.elementor-widget-document-widget .document-part h4,.elementor-widget-document-widget .document-part h5,.elementor-widget-document-widget .document-part h6{margin-top:2.3rem;margin-bottom:.1rem}.elementor-widget-document-widget .anchor-point{padding-top:60px;margin-top:-60px}.elementor-widget-document-widget-toc .elementor-widget-container>ul{padding-left:0}ul.document-listing{list-style:none;padding-left:20px;font-weight:500}ul.document-listing li{padding:5px 0;line-height:20px}ul.document-listing li a.elementor-button{font-family:Roboto,Sans-serif}.elementor-widget-haus-edit-user .user-details{position:relative}.elementor-widget-haus-edit-user .user-details .blocker{position:absolute;background-color:hsla(0,0%,100%,.5);top:0;left:0;right:0;bottom:0;display:none}.elementor-widget-haus-edit-user .user-details .blocker.active{display:block}.elementor-widget-haus-edit-user .user-details .field-row{display:-ms-flexbox;display:flex}.elementor-widget-haus-edit-user .user-details .field-row.passwords.error input{border-color:red}.elementor-widget-haus-edit-user .user-details .field-row .field{-ms-flex:1;flex:1;padding:15px}.elementor-widget-haus-edit-user .user-details .field-row.submit{display:block;text-align:center}.elementor-widget-haus-edit-user button[type=submit]{border:0;margin:15px auto}.elementor-widget-haus-edit-user button[type=submit][disabled]{opacity:.75}.elementor-widget-haus-edit-user .status{font-weight:700;display:block}.elementor-button-but-just-link{background-color:transparent!important;position:relative}.elementor-button-but-just-link.sub-trigger{display:-ms-flexbox;display:flex}.elementor-button-but-just-link.sub-trigger.triggered~ul.haus-button-sub-list{background-color:#fff;box-shadow:0 0 20px rgba(0,0,0,.25);transform:translateX(-10px);padding:10px}.elementor-button-but-just-link.sub-trigger.triggered~ul.haus-button-sub-list li{border-bottom-width:1px;border-bottom-style:solid;border-color:#dde3e7;margin:0;transition:all .27s ease}.elementor-button-but-just-link.sub-trigger.triggered~ul.haus-button-sub-list li:hover{background-color:#dde3e7}.elementor-button-but-just-link.sub-trigger.triggered~ul.haus-button-sub-list li:last-child{border-bottom:0}.elementor-button-but-just-link.sub-trigger.triggered~ul.haus-button-sub-list a{background-color:transparent;box-shadow:none;padding:15px 20px;text-align:left;display:block}.elementor-button-but-just-link .elementor-button-text{text-align:left}ul.haus-button-sub-list{display:none}.sub-trigger:active,.sub-trigger:focus{outline:none}.sub-trigger.triggered~ul.haus-button-sub-list{position:absolute;z-index:9;display:table;padding:0;list-style:none}.sub-trigger.triggered~ul.haus-button-sub-list li{text-align:left;margin:5px 0}.sub-trigger.triggered~ul.haus-button-sub-list li a{transform:translateY(-10px);opacity:0;animation:slide-down .5s ease forwards}@keyframes slide-down{0%{transform:translateY(-10px);opacity:0}to{transform:translateY(0);opacity:1}}.elementor-button.locked i.fa,.elementor-button.locked i.far,.elementor-button.locked i.fas{font-weight:900}.elementor-button.locked i.fa:before,.elementor-button.locked i.far:before,.elementor-button.locked i.fas:before{content:"\f023"}.haus-modal{position:fixed;top:0;left:0;right:0;bottom:0;background-color:hsla(0,0%,100%,.75);z-index:999;display:none;opacity:0;animation:fade-in .5s ease forwards;-ms-flex-pack:center;justify-content:center;-ms-flex-align:center;align-items:center}.haus-modal.show{display:-ms-flexbox;display:flex}@keyframes fade-in{0%{opacity:0}to{opacity:1}}.haus-modal .inner{max-width:95%;max-height:70vh;width:800px;background-color:#fff;border-radius:3px;box-shadow:0 0 20px rgba(0,0,0,.25);overflow:auto;position:relative;transform:translateY(15px);animation:slide-up .5s ease forwards;z-index:999}@keyframes slide-up{0%{transform:translateY(15px)}to{transform:translateY(0)}}.haus-modal .inner .close{position:absolute;top:0;right:0;border:0}.haus-modal .inner .text-white{color:#fff}.haus-modal .inner>div{-ms-flex:1;flex:1;padding:48px;-ms-flex-pack:center;justify-content:center;display:-ms-flexbox;display:flex;-ms-flex-flow:column nowrap;flex-flow:column nowrap}.elementor-widget-document-widget-search .elementor-widget-container{overflow:hidden;position:relative}mark[data-markjs].marked{box-shadow:0 1px 5px rgba(0,0,0,.2);position:relative}mark[data-markjs].marked:before{content:"";background-color:inherit;position:absolute;animation:markPulse .3s ease;top:0;left:0;bottom:0;right:0;z-index:-1}@keyframes markPulse{to{transform:scale(1.2)}}.mark-counter{position:absolute;background-color:hsla(0,0%,100%,.5);right:-200px;top:1px;bottom:1px;transition:right .4s ease;z-index:1}.mark-counter.slideIn{right:1px}.mark-counter .status{padding:10px;border-left:1px solid #fff;display:-ms-flexbox;display:flex;-ms-flex-align:center;align-items:center;color:#333}.mark-counter .buttons,.mark-counter .status{float:left;height:100%}.mark-counter .buttons button{height:100%;color:#333;border-radius:0;border:0;border-left:1px solid #fff;background-color:hsla(0,0%,100%,.5)}.elementor-widget-haus-reset-password .reset-pass{text-align:center}.elementor-widget-haus-reset-password form{text-align:center;position:relative;padding:10px 0}.elementor-widget-haus-reset-password form#wp_pass_update .output-msg,.elementor-widget-haus-reset-password form .inner.inactive{display:none}.elementor-widget-haus-reset-password form#wp_pass_update .output-msg.active{display:block;background:#ef7e65;padding:10px 15px;color:#fff;border-radius:30px}.elementor-widget-haus-reset-password form .descr{margin-bottom:30px}.elementor-widget-haus-reset-password form .input-field{max-width:600px;margin:15px auto}.elementor-widget-haus-reset-password form .input-field .label{text-align:left;padding-left:2px;width:100%;display:block;padding-bottom:4px}.elementor-widget-haus-reset-password form input[type=email],.elementor-widget-haus-reset-password form input[type=password],.elementor-widget-haus-reset-password form input[type=text]{background:rgba(9,19,33,.08);border:none;font-size:18px;padding:10px 15px;box-shadow:0 0 0 1px rgba(9,19,33,0);transition:box-shadow .2s ease}.elementor-widget-haus-reset-password form input[type=email]:active,.elementor-widget-haus-reset-password form input[type=email]:focus,.elementor-widget-haus-reset-password form input[type=password]:active,.elementor-widget-haus-reset-password form input[type=password]:focus,.elementor-widget-haus-reset-password form input[type=text]:active,.elementor-widget-haus-reset-password form input[type=text]:focus{box-shadow:0 0 0 1px #091321}.elementor-widget-haus-reset-password form button[type=submit]{border:none;font-weight:700;min-width:180px;text-align:center;outline:none}.elementor-widget-haus-reset-password form .cover{display:none}.elementor-widget-haus-reset-password form .cover.active{display:block;position:absolute;top:0;left:0;width:100%;height:100%;background-color:hsla(0,0%,100%,.8);background-image:url(preloader.svg);background-position:50%;background-size:80px auto;background-repeat:no-repeat}.tab-wpnav.loading:before{width:70px;height:70px;border-radius:50%;border:5px solid #ed765e;animation:loadingspin 3s linear infinite}.tab-wpnav.loading:after,.tab-wpnav.loading:before{content:"";position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);z-index:6}.tab-wpnav.loading:after{background-image:url(../assets/images/Favicon_fastigo.svg);width:59px;height:59px;border:4px solid #fff;border-radius:50%}@keyframes loadingspin{0%{border-right-color:#ed765e;border-top-color:transparent}25%{border-top-color:#ed765e;border-left-color:transparent}50%{border-left-color:#ed765e;border-bottom-color:transparent}75%{border-bottom-color:#ed765e;border-right-color:transparent}to{border-right-color:#ed765e;border-top-color:transparent;transform:translate(-50%,-50%) rotate(1turn)}}.tab-wpnav.loading .eael-tabs-content,.tab-wpnav.loading .eael-tabs-nav{opacity:.5}.eael-advance-tabs .eael-tabs-nav>ul li{-ms-flex:1;flex:1}
/*# sourceMappingURL=main.css.map */
